Understanding Sanitization Services Severity in Demarest Properties
Sanitization in Demarest rarely means a light disinfectant pass. Homes here are mostly 1930s-1960s Colonials, Tudors, and Capes with full basements, original cast-iron drain stacks, and framing that predates modern moisture barriers. When water enters those spaces, it carries contaminants that get classified by source. Category 2 water, from washing machine overflows or sump failures, contains significant bacterial load. Category 3 water, from sewer backups or storm runoff, carries pathogens and requires full containment, antimicrobial treatment, and often removal of saturated porous materials. The severity multiplies when moisture hides behind finished walls, under old-growth oak flooring, or inside a shared crawl space where a 1950s split-level addition meets fieldstone foundation. We run thermal imaging and hygrometer readings to find what surface cleaning misses. On these hillside lots, clay-heavy soil holds water against foundation walls long after the storm passes, so a “dry” basement slab can still be releasing moisture into the air days later. That moisture feeds bacteria in ductwork and wall cavities. The right sequence is drying first, then sanitization. Skipping the drying step means you’re disinfecting surfaces while the source keeps feeding contamination behind them.

Our Sanitization Services Process
Inspection & Assessment
We start with a room-by-room walkthrough, thermal imaging, and hygrometer readings to map moisture and contamination. In Demarest’s older homes, that means checking behind baseboards, inside wall cavities, and under slabs where hidden water collects.

Extraction & Stabilization
We remove standing water and begin containment. In a finished basement or crawl space, we isolate the affected zone before disturbance spreads bacteria through the air.

Drying & Dehumidification
Professional-grade Dri-Eaz air movers and Phoenix dehumidifiers pull moisture from wood, concrete, and drywall. Daily readings are logged until the dry standard is met, not just until surfaces feel dry.

Cleaning & Sanitization
We apply antimicrobial treatments to every exposed surface using HEPA-filtered equipment. On category 3 losses, we cut affected drywall and fog cavities with a commercial-grade disinfectant before rebuilding.

Air Duct & Crawl Space Treatment
Demarest homes with original ductwork and shared crawl spaces get focused sanitization in those hidden zones. We fog ducts and treat insulation where freeze-thaw cracks let contaminated water in.

Repairs & Restoration
We replace what was removed, match original trim and materials where possible, and hand you a completed moisture log. The 90-Day Done Right Promise backs the work in writing.

Built for Demarest’s Loss Calendar
Demarest’s sanitization calls follow the seasons. January and February bring hard freezes that burst supply lines in uninsulated crawl spaces and garage-adjacent walls, sending clean water through finished basements until it stagnates into a bacterial problem. March and April bring snowmelt running off the steep, wooded hillsides onto clay-heavy soil that holds moisture against fieldstone foundations. Nor’easters in late fall and winter drive groundwater into basements and saturate ductwork. Summer thunderstorms send flash runoff down Hardenburgh Avenue and the ridge streets, overwhelming drainage on lots built before modern codes. A single storm can hit roof, siding, and basement at once on those sloped lots, so sanitization often follows extraction on a multi-system loss. We plan for that pattern, not against it.

Specialized Sanitization Services Services We Offer in Demarest
Deep Disinfection
For bacteria-heavy losses like sewer backups or standing water from a failed sump, deep disinfection means more than a spray-and-wipe. We treat every surface in the affected zone, including subflooring after carpet removal, wall cavities where water wicked upward, and baseboards that hide mold behind old-growth oak trim. In Demarest basements with fieldstone walls, we pay special attention to the mortar joints where contaminated water collected and dried, leaving spores behind.
Virus & Bacteria Decontamination
After a household illness, norovirus outbreak, or post-flood contamination, we use EPA-registered disinfectants applied to dwell-time standards, not rushed passes. On Demarest Tudors with multiple small rooms and original plaster, we treat room by room, including switch plates, door hardware, and HVAC returns. Our crews follow IICRC protocols for pathogen decontamination and document every surface treated.
Odor Neutralization
Odors from water damage don’t lift with a quick spray. They settle into ductwork, insulation, and behind trim. We pair air scrubbing with HEPA filtration and targeted fogging to neutralize what’s causing the smell, not just mask it. For Demarest homes with original duct runs that have never been cleaned, this step often makes the difference between “it smells okay when the windows are open” and “it smells like it did before.”
Air Duct Sanitization
This matters more in Demarest than most people realize. Homes built between 1930 and 1965 frequently have original ductwork, often routed through unsealed crawl spaces and behind walls that saw decades of moisture. When category 2 or 3 water enters a basement, contaminated air moves into those ducts. We fog the runs, clean returns, and treat registers so the HVAC system isn’t recirculating bacteria into every room. On Tudors with original knob-and-tube wiring chases, we check the routing before fogging so aggressive treatment doesn’t push contaminated dust into electrical pathways.
Commercial-Grade Fogging
For whole-home contamination or post-illness cleanup, commercial fogging reaches spaces surface wiping can’t: inside wall cavities, behind built-ins, into crawl space framing. We use professional fogging equipment with EPA-registered disinfectants at proper dwell times. On Demarest Colonials with finished basements and multiple finished walls, fogging the cavity after controlled drywall removal is standard practice before we rebuild.
Sanitization Services Costs in Demarest, NJ
A single-room sanitization after a clean-water loss in Demarest typically runs $450-$900 depending on surface area and whether drywall needs cutting. Air duct sanitization for a whole home, including fogging and return cleaning, usually falls between $600-$1,400 based on run count and contamination level. Commercial-grade fogging for a full basement or post-illness whole-home treatment runs $900-$2,200. If structural drying is needed first, that adds $800-$2,000 depending on square footage and how long equipment stays in place. Sewage backup sanitization, which includes category 3 protocol, removal of saturated materials, and full antimicrobial treatment, typically lands between $1,500-$4,000 in Demarest homes. What moves the price: finished wall removal, crawl space access, duct complexity on older original systems, and whether original trim or plaster needs matching during repair. Most of these costs are insurance-covered when tied to a covered loss. We provide a free inspection and a firm written scope before any work starts, so the number you see is the number you pay. Can sanitization alone fix a Demarest basement that flooded during a nor’easter, or do we need structural drying too?
No. Sanitization without drying fails. In a Demarest basement with saturated wood, concrete, and drywall, moisture keeps feeding bacteria and mold even after surfaces are treated. Structural drying with air movers and dehumidifiers must precede or run parallel to sanitization, and drying logs should confirm the moisture is gone before rebuild. Our 1950s Colonial in Demarest had a sewer backup. Does air duct sanitization remove the odor from the finished basement?
It helps, but the odor source must be removed first. Sewer backup is category 3 water, so saturated drywall, insulation, and any padding must be cut and disposed of. Then we fog the duct runs, clean returns, and treat the airspace. If contaminated air settled into the HVAC, duct sanitization is what prevents the smell from returning every time the system cycles. Why does a Demarest Tudor with a steep roof need post-illness cleanup after a burst pipe?
Because water from a burst pipe, even clean water, becomes category 2 after 48 hours of stagnation. In a Tudor with narrow wall cavities and original plaster, that stagnant water wicks upward and creates bacteria that moves through the home when the heat runs. Post-illness cleanup protocols address the pathogen load after drying is complete, and on those steep-roof homes we also check attic and ceiling cavities where water traveled before it pooled in the basement.
How do you sanitize a Demarest house without damaging original 1930s wood trim and plaster walls?
We test first. Original shellac, varnish, and oil-based finishes respond differently to disinfectants, so we spot-test in an inconspicuous area before treating exposed trim. Where plaster is involved, we use low-pressure application and controlled drying to avoid cracking. When cutting is required behind trim, we remove it carefully where feasible and restore it during the rebuild phase. Can we stay in the house during sanitization?
It depends on the contamination level and the treatment type. For category 2 or 3 water, we recommend vacating the affected floor during fogging and for the required dwell time afterward. For surface-only sanitization of a contained area, staying may be fine. Our crew gives you a clear answer during inspection, before any work begins.
What should I do in the first 30 minutes after a flood or contamination event in Demarest?
Shut off water at the main if it’s from a burst pipe. Cut power to the affected area if water has reached outlets or appliances. Move what you can without walking through contaminated water.
